Charleston, SC vs Twin Falls, ID *
Cost of Living Comparison
Twin Falls, ID * is more affordable by 8.9 index points
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Category | Charleston, SC | Twin Falls, ID * |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 101.0 | 92.1 | +8.9 |
| Housing | 119.8 | 73.8 | +45.9 |
| Goods | 96.3 | 96.2 | +0.2 |
| Utilities | 88.2 | 70.0 | +18.2 |
| Other Services | 98.3 | 99.0 | -0.7 |
Income & Housing Comparison
| Metric | Charleston, SC | Twin Falls, ID * |
|---|---|---|
| Median Household Income | $77,460 | $62,912 |
| Median Home Value | $317,300 | $255,000 |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,402 | $929 |
| Per Capita Income | $44,457 | $31,515 |
